Describe what happens to enzyme activity when temperature increases beyond the optimum.


✔✔The enzyme activity decreases because the enzyme becomes denatured and its active site

changes shape.




Explain why stomata are mostly found on the underside of a leaf.


✔✔To reduce water loss by evaporation due to lower exposure to sunlight.




Define osmosis.


✔✔Osmosis is the movement of water molecules from a region of higher water concentration to

a region of lower water concentration through a selectively permeable membrane.




Suggest a reason why white blood cells increase during an infection.


✔✔To fight off pathogens by producing antibodies or engulfing bacteria.




1

, Predict what would happen to a plant cell in a solution with very low water concentration.


✔✔The cell would lose water and become plasmolysed.




Compare mitosis and meiosis in terms of chromosome number.


✔✔Mitosis produces cells with the same number of chromosomes as the parent cell, while

meiosis halves the chromosome number.




Identify one structure that is found in plant cells but not in animal cells.


✔✔Chloroplast




Calculate the number of cells produced after four rounds of mitotic division starting from one

cell.


✔✔Sixteen cells




Explain the role of insulin in the body.


✔✔Insulin lowers blood glucose levels by promoting the uptake of glucose into cells and storage

as glycogen in the liver.
